Abstract

Effects of controlled feeding on the growth and development of tobacco cutworm larvae (Spodoptera litura) were studied.In contrast with azadirachtin,the growth and development of tobacco cutworm were measured under natural condition.The 3rd instar larvae of tobacco cutworm were treated with controlled feeding.The results showed that the fewer was the feeding amount,the greater the effect of growth inhibition was,the longer the duration of development was and the higher the mortality was.But the pupation rate and eclosion rate were not obviously affected.The 3rd instar larvae of tobacco cutworm were treated with azadirachtin at different concentration.Results showed that the higher the concentration of azadirachtin was,the greater the effect of growth inhibition was.The duration of larvae treated with azadirachtin became longer and the mortality was higher.It was similar with the results of controlled feeding.Moreover, the pupation rate and eclosion rate of larvae treated with azadirachtin were obviously lower, and it did not tally with the results of controlled feeding.The probable reason was that azadirachtin had inhibition activity of growth and development in addition to antifeeding activity.
